Output dc39f100e11aa33e008d08915d23d5e97412f5006e632c38256c644bebc2508b:14

value
8644662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d09c97a10ec5cc3f42dd433dcdd0073d739d96 OP_EQUAL
address
3MBZkzq62Nb9HU8TLjNmpsVvjsQhy3xDfE
transaction
dc39f100e11aa33e008d08915d23d5e97412f5006e632c38256c644bebc2508b